"I checked the yaboot.conf and it looks correct. It shows MacOS on
/dev/hda5, linux on /dev/hda10. I tried running ybin, which ran, but
seemingly did
nothing. "

- Are you sure that Macos9? X? is /dev/hda5? I have a triple boot system
with macos9, x.1 and YDL 2.1. The first, (usually 6-8 partitions) are
automatically created by mac for it's own use. The first, usually, available
partition as Linux see's it is /dev/hda9. It sound like ybin is working but
finds no operating system at /dev/hda5.
